Chilli Tuna is a flavorful dish that combines tender chunks of tuna with a spicy chili-infused marinade or sauce. Originating from a fusion of seafood and spice-rich cuisines, it often takes inspiration from Asian or Mediterranean culinary traditions. Packed with protein and omega-3 fatty acids, tuna is an excellent source of nutrients that support heart health, brain function, and muscle repair. The chili component adds a kick of spice and contains capsaicin, which may help boost metabolism and reduce inflammation. Depending on preparation, the dish can be calorie-conscious, particularly when grilled or paired with fresh vegetables. However, variations made with excess oils, heavy sauces, or processed additives may increase fat and sodium levels. Overall, Chilli Tuna offers a nutritious option for those seeking bold flavors while benefiting from the health properties of fresh seafood.
